Output 80df4da81e2e358794f5c875f18731bc2548aca61cd8682a6261fb886ce90ef9:1

value
13606260
script pubkey
OP_0 OP_PUSHBYTES_20 8d3ae0b1421ca757a9489d25f83eef80d40b10e4
address
bc1q35awpv2zrjn4022gn5jls0h0sr2qky8yzd36v6
transaction
80df4da81e2e358794f5c875f18731bc2548aca61cd8682a6261fb886ce90ef9